The Andhra Pradesh Lorry Owners Association organised an agitation at Ichchapuram exhorting all truckers to participate in the strike.
The association representatives M. Janakiram Reddy and Gude Vasu, leading the agitation at the town bordering Odisha, said truckers had been the worst hit by the rocketing diesel prices.
Maintenance cost, payment of wages to drivers and competition among the truck owners had already led to problems in the sector, they said.
The association was participating in the strike as the government was delaying a speedy redress, they added
